At the moment, I have 1 actual event, split into 2 EventBooking events, for junior and senior kids. I use the cart and I collect member details. I accept deposits until a certain time before the event.

A parent registers a junior child and a senior child, and secures their place by paying a deposit. So there is a completion payment to be made through EB. At the appropriate time, EB sends 2 emails requesting payment, and the customer must complete 2 individual transactions to complete the payment.

Can this please be changed to 1 EB email with 1 deposit completion transaction required.

Having 2 seperate transactions is:
1) Confusing to the customer
2) Is more work for the customer
3) Can lead to work for us, as I often need to chase customers who have only completed 1 of the payments.
4) Costs us in transaction fees

I will have to think to see whether we could implement something like that. Right now, when cart is used, registration for each event is actually independent, that's why there would be multiple remaining payments. It is not supported now, but we might be able to support it in the future

I'm doing the accounts at the moment, and the seperate treatment of registrants, when it comes to multiple deposit completion payments is proving very difficult to deal with.

Having looked in the tables, you have a couple of things to link the items together... 1 is cart_id and the second, probably more useful field is registration_code.

Could you update the deposit completion so that
1) Only 1 email request is automatically sent requesting the total
2) [DEPOSIT_PAYMENT_LINK] shows the total remaining to be paid for the multiple reigstrations.
3) 1 Deposit Completion required for multiple event registrations

This change would make your system consistent. At the moment, a transaction with multiple events but with 100% payment up front is treated differently to transactions with multiple events, but paid using a deposit, followed by a completion payment.
